summaryrefslogtreecommitdiff
path: root/docs/src/data/groups.js
diff options
context:
space:
mode:
Diffstat (limited to 'docs/src/data/groups.js')
-rw-r--r--docs/src/data/groups.js414
1 files changed, 414 insertions, 0 deletions
diff --git a/docs/src/data/groups.js b/docs/src/data/groups.js
new file mode 100644
index 0000000..f7ced16
--- /dev/null
+++ b/docs/src/data/groups.js
@@ -0,0 +1,414 @@
+/*
+ * Copyright (c) 2020 The ZMK Contributors
+ *
+ * SPDX-License-Identifier: CC-BY-NC-SA-4.0
+ */
+
+export default {
+ "application-controls": [
+ "K_MENU",
+ "C_AC_PROPERTIES",
+ "K_SELECT",
+ "C_AC_CANCEL",
+ "K_EXECUTE",
+ "C_AC_REFRESH",
+ "K_REFRESH",
+ "C_AC_STOP",
+ "K_STOP",
+ "C_AC_FORWARD",
+ "K_FORWARD",
+ "C_AC_BACK",
+ "K_BACK",
+ "C_AC_HOME",
+ "C_AC_BOOKMARKS",
+ "C_AC_NEW",
+ "C_AC_OPEN",
+ "C_AC_SAVE",
+ "C_AC_CLOSE",
+ "C_AC_EXIT",
+ "C_AC_PRINT",
+ "C_AC_FIND",
+ "K_FIND",
+ "K_FIND2",
+ "C_AC_SEARCH",
+ "C_AC_GOTO",
+ "C_AC_ZOOM",
+ "C_AC_ZOOM_IN",
+ "C_AC_ZOOM_OUT",
+ "C_AC_SCROLL_UP",
+ "K_SCROLL_UP",
+ "C_AC_SCROLL_DOWN",
+ "K_SCROLL_DOWN",
+ "C_AC_REPLY",
+ "C_AC_FORWARD_MAIL",
+ "C_AC_SEND",
+ "C_AC_EDIT",
+ "C_AC_INSERT",
+ "C_AC_DEL",
+ "C_AC_VIEW_TOGGLE",
+ "C_AC_DESKTOP_SHOW_ALL_WINDOWS",
+ "C_VOICE_COMMAND",
+ ],
+ applications: [
+ "C_AL_NEXT_TASK",
+ "C_AL_PREVIOUS_TASK",
+ "C_AL_SELECT_TASK",
+ "C_AL_MY_COMPUTER",
+ "C_AL_DOCUMENTS",
+ "C_AL_FILE_BROWSER",
+ "C_AL_WWW",
+ "K_WWW",
+ "C_AL_EMAIL",
+ "C_AL_INSTANT_MESSAGING",
+ "C_AL_NETWORK_CHAT",
+ "C_AL_CONTACTS",
+ "C_AL_CALENDAR",
+ "C_AL_IMAGE_BROWSER",
+ "C_AL_AUDIO_BROWSER",
+ "C_AL_MOVIE_BROWSER",
+ "C_AL_TEXT_EDITOR",
+ "C_AL_WORD",
+ "C_AL_SPREADSHEET",
+ "C_AL_PRESENTATION",
+ "C_AL_GRAPHICS_EDITOR",
+ "C_AL_CALCULATOR",
+ "K_CALCULATOR",
+ "C_AL_NEWS",
+ "C_AL_DATABASE",
+ "C_AL_VOICEMAIL",
+ "C_AL_FINANCE",
+ "C_AL_TASK_MANAGER",
+ "C_AL_JOURNAL",
+ "C_AL_AV_CAPTURE_PLAYBACK",
+ "C_AL_SPELLCHECK",
+ "C_AL_SCREEN_SAVER",
+ "C_AL_KEYBOARD_LAYOUT",
+ "C_AL_CONTROL_PANEL",
+ "C_AL_HELP",
+ "K_HELP",
+ "C_AL_OEM_FEATURES",
+ "C_AL_CCC",
+ ],
+ "consumer-controls": [
+ "C_CHANNEL_INC",
+ "C_CHANNEL_DEC",
+ "C_RECALL_LAST",
+ "C_MEDIA_VCR_PLUS",
+ "C_MEDIA_GUIDE",
+ "C_MEDIA_STEP",
+ "C_MEDIA_HOME",
+ "C_MEDIA_TV",
+ "C_MEDIA_CABLE",
+ "C_MEDIA_TUNER",
+ "C_MEDIA_DVD",
+ "C_MEDIA_CD",
+ "C_MEDIA_SATELLITE",
+ "C_MEDIA_VCR",
+ "C_MEDIA_TAPE",
+ "C_MEDIA_COMPUTER",
+ "C_MEDIA_WWW",
+ "C_MEDIA_GAMES",
+ "C_MEDIA_PHONE",
+ "C_MEDIA_VIDEOPHONE",
+ "C_MEDIA_MESSAGES",
+ "C_QUIT",
+ "C_HELP",
+ ],
+ "consumer-menus": [
+ "C_MENU",
+ "C_MENU_PICK",
+ "C_MENU_UP",
+ "C_MENU_DOWN",
+ "C_MENU_LEFT",
+ "C_MENU_RIGHT",
+ "C_MENU_ESCAPE",
+ "C_MENU_INCREASE",
+ "C_MENU_DECREASE",
+ "C_RED_BUTTON",
+ "C_GREEN_BUTTON",
+ "C_BLUE_BUTTON",
+ "C_YELLOW_BUTTON",
+ ],
+ "cut-copy-paste": [
+ "C_AC_CUT",
+ "K_CUT",
+ "C_AC_COPY",
+ "K_COPY",
+ "C_AC_PASTE",
+ "K_PASTE",
+ ],
+ display: [
+ "C_BRIGHTNESS_INC",
+ "C_BRIGHTNESS_DEC",
+ "C_BRIGHTNESS_MINIMUM",
+ "C_BRIGHTNESS_MAXIMUM",
+ "C_BRIGHTNESS_AUTO",
+ "C_BACKLIGHT_TOGGLE",
+ "C_ASPECT",
+ "C_PIP",
+ ],
+ "input-assist": [
+ "C_KEYBOARD_INPUT_ASSIST_NEXT",
+ "C_KEYBOARD_INPUT_ASSIST_PREVIOUS",
+ "C_KEYBOARD_INPUT_ASSIST_NEXT_GROUP",
+ "C_KEYBOARD_INPUT_ASSIST_PREVIOUS_GROUP",
+ "C_KEYBOARD_INPUT_ASSIST_ACCEPT",
+ "C_KEYBOARD_INPUT_ASSIST_CANCEL",
+ ],
+ "keyboard-control-whitespace": [
+ "ESCAPE",
+ "RETURN",
+ "RETURN2",
+ "SPACE",
+ "TAB",
+ "BACKSPACE",
+ "DELETE",
+ "INSERT",
+ ],
+ "keyboard-fkeys": [
+ "F1",
+ "F2",
+ "F3",
+ "F4",
+ "F5",
+ "F6",
+ "F7",
+ "F8",
+ "F9",
+ "F10",
+ "F11",
+ "F12",
+ "F13",
+ "F14",
+ "F15",
+ "F16",
+ "F17",
+ "F18",
+ "F19",
+ "F20",
+ "F21",
+ "F22",
+ "F23",
+ "F24",
+ ],
+ "keyboard-international": [
+ "INTERNATIONAL_1",
+ "INTERNATIONAL_2",
+ "INTERNATIONAL_3",
+ "INTERNATIONAL_4",
+ "INTERNATIONAL_5",
+ "INTERNATIONAL_6",
+ "INTERNATIONAL_7",
+ "INTERNATIONAL_8",
+ "INTERNATIONAL_9",
+ ],
+ "keyboard-language": [
+ "LANGUAGE_1",
+ "LANGUAGE_2",
+ "LANGUAGE_3",
+ "LANGUAGE_4",
+ "LANGUAGE_5",
+ "LANGUAGE_6",
+ "LANGUAGE_7",
+ "LANGUAGE_8",
+ "LANGUAGE_9",
+ ],
+ "keyboard-letters": [
+ "A",
+ "B",
+ "C",
+ "D",
+ "E",
+ "F",
+ "G",
+ "H",
+ "I",
+ "J",
+ "K",
+ "L",
+ "M",
+ "N",
+ "O",
+ "P",
+ "Q",
+ "R",
+ "S",
+ "T",
+ "U",
+ "V",
+ "W",
+ "X",
+ "Y",
+ "Z",
+ ],
+ "keyboard-locks": [
+ "CAPSLOCK",
+ "LOCKING_CAPS",
+ "SCROLLLOCK",
+ "LOCKING_SCROLL",
+ "LOCKING_NUM",
+ ],
+ "keyboard-miscellaneous": [
+ "PRINTSCREEN",
+ "PAUSE_BREAK",
+ "ALT_ERASE",
+ "SYSREQ",
+ "K_CANCEL",
+ "CLEAR",
+ "CLEAR_AGAIN",
+ "CRSEL",
+ "PRIOR",
+ "SEPARATOR",
+ "OUT",
+ "OPER",
+ "EXSEL",
+ "K_EDIT",
+ ],
+ "keyboard-modifiers": [
+ "LEFT_SHIFT",
+ "RIGHT_SHIFT",
+ "LEFT_CONTROL",
+ "RIGHT_CONTROL",
+ "LEFT_ALT",
+ "RIGHT_ALT",
+ "LEFT_GUI",
+ "RIGHT_GUI",
+ ],
+ "keyboard-navigation": [
+ "HOME",
+ "END",
+ "PAGE_UP",
+ "PAGE_DOWN",
+ "UP_ARROW",
+ "DOWN_ARROW",
+ "LEFT_ARROW",
+ "RIGHT_ARROW",
+ "K_APPLICATION",
+ ],
+ "keyboard-numbers": [
+ "NUMBER_1",
+ "NUMBER_2",
+ "NUMBER_3",
+ "NUMBER_4",
+ "NUMBER_5",
+ "NUMBER_6",
+ "NUMBER_7",
+ "NUMBER_8",
+ "NUMBER_9",
+ "NUMBER_0",
+ ],
+ "keyboard-symbols": [
+ "EXCLAMATION",
+ "AT_SIGN",
+ "HASH",
+ "DOLLAR",
+ "PERCENT",
+ "CARET",
+ "AMPERSAND",
+ "ASTERISK",
+ "LEFT_PARENTHESIS",
+ "RIGHT_PARENTHESIS",
+ "EQUAL",
+ "PLUS",
+ "MINUS",
+ "UNDERSCORE",
+ "SLASH",
+ "QUESTION",
+ "BACKSLASH",
+ "PIPE",
+ "NON_US_BACKSLASH",
+ "PIPE2",
+ "SEMICOLON",
+ "COLON",
+ "SINGLE_QUOTE",
+ "DOUBLE_QUOTES",
+ "COMMA",
+ "LESS_THAN",
+ "PERIOD",
+ "GREATER_THAN",
+ "LEFT_BRACKET",
+ "LEFT_BRACE",
+ "RIGHT_BRACKET",
+ "RIGHT_BRACE",
+ "GRAVE",
+ "TILDE",
+ "NON_US_HASH",
+ "TILDE2",
+ ],
+ keypad: ["KP_NUMLOCK", "KP_CLEAR", "CLEAR2", "KP_ENTER"],
+ "keypad-numbers": [
+ "KP_NUMBER_1",
+ "KP_NUMBER_2",
+ "KP_NUMBER_3",
+ "KP_NUMBER_4",
+ "KP_NUMBER_5",
+ "KP_NUMBER_6",
+ "KP_NUMBER_7",
+ "KP_NUMBER_8",
+ "KP_NUMBER_9",
+ "KP_NUMBER_0",
+ ],
+ "keypad-operations": [
+ "KP_PLUS",
+ "KP_MINUS",
+ "KP_MULTIPLY",
+ "KP_DIVIDE",
+ "KP_EQUAL",
+ "KP_EQUAL_AS400",
+ "KP_DOT",
+ "KP_COMMA",
+ "KP_LEFT_PARENTHESIS",
+ "KP_RIGHT_PARENTHESIS",
+ ],
+ "media-controls": [
+ "C_RECORD",
+ "C_PLAY",
+ "C_PLAY_PAUSE",
+ "K_PLAY_PAUSE",
+ "C_PAUSE",
+ "C_STOP",
+ "K_STOP2",
+ "K_STOP3",
+ "C_STOP_EJECT",
+ "C_EJECT",
+ "K_EJECT",
+ "C_NEXT",
+ "K_NEXT",
+ "C_PREVIOUS",
+ "K_PREVIOUS",
+ "C_FAST_FORWARD",
+ "C_REWIND",
+ "C_SLOW",
+ "C_SLOW_TRACKING",
+ "C_REPEAT",
+ "C_RANDOM_PLAY",
+ "C_CAPTIONS",
+ "C_DATA_ON_SCREEN",
+ "C_SNAPSHOT",
+ ],
+ power: [
+ "C_POWER",
+ "K_POWER",
+ "C_RESET",
+ "C_SLEEP",
+ "K_SLEEP",
+ "C_SLEEP_MODE",
+ "C_AL_LOGOFF",
+ "C_AL_LOCK",
+ "K_LOCK",
+ ],
+ sound: [
+ "C_VOLUME_UP",
+ "K_VOLUME_UP",
+ "K_VOLUME_UP2",
+ "C_VOLUME_DOWN",
+ "K_VOLUME_DOWN",
+ "K_VOLUME_DOWN2",
+ "C_MUTE",
+ "K_MUTE",
+ "K_MUTE2",
+ "C_ALTERNATE_AUDIO_INCREMENT",
+ "C_BASS_BOOST",
+ ],
+ "undo-redo": ["C_AC_UNDO", "K_UNDO", "C_AC_REDO", "K_AGAIN"],
+};